translated from Spanish: President Piñera inaugurated the fondas of the O’Higgins Park and the celebration of Fiestas Patrias

the President Sebastian Pinera participated in the inauguration of the fondas of the O’Higgins Park in the commune of Santiago, where he made a call to the unit and joked with some of the anecdotes of his six-month Government. The President called on citizens to celebrate with joy and recalled that in 2017, 22 people died of alcohol-related traffic accidents, by which asked that you people will drink during the celebrations do not lead. Pinera also said that Chile should aspire to be the first country in Latin America – and not only – that manages the development and called for unity of the country. The President also performed the traditional “clowns” in which praised the administration of the Mayor of Santiago Felipe Alessandri and dedicated some words to the first lady, Cecilia Morel.En another of the clowns the President alluded to the oranges that were hanging in the courtyards of La Moneda, for dinner in honor to the President of the Spanish Government, Pedro Sánchez.A the intendant of Coquimbo, Karla Rubilar, who was his companion during the traditional foot of cueca of the authorities, President Piñera He devoted one of the clowns, telling not feared because on this occasion not will cut into her hair, in allusion to some trusses in the metropolitan region, that went on to take the scalp of the regional authority. “Viva Chile, long live our wonderful country,” said the President.
